Discovery Place KIDS-Huntersville today welcomed its 1,000,000th visitor to the Museum.

Yolanda Zheng, age 3, and her parents Jiangxia Sun and Yuan Qin Zheng of Charlotte were the lucky visitors that arrived Tuesday, May 31 at 10:30 a.m. to find themselves becoming part of the Museum’s history.

Discovery Place KIDS staff surprised the family with applause, confetti and balloons as they entered the Museum. Yolanda was presented with a special prize package to mark the occasion, including a one-year family Membership to the Museum. The Museum’s mascot, Can Can, then gathered everyone for a commemorative group photo.

“We are so lucky!” said Yolanda's mother, Jiangxia Sun. “This is our first time visiting the Museum with our daughter, Yolanda. We were so surprised when we walked in to all the excitement. We can’t wait to share this with all of our friends and family.”

Since opening its doors in October 2010, Discovery Place KIDS-Huntersville has seen over 70,000 students from schools, conducted over 2,200 birthday parties, taught nearly 700 school classes and currently serves nearly 5,000 Member households.

The Museum marked its fifth birthday in October 2015.
